In a statement reported by tradealpha, US President Donald Trump asserted that the ongoing boom in artificial intelligence and data centers is solely attributable to the United States being far ahead of all other countries. He cautioned against policies or actions that could undermine this advantage, using the metaphor of not killing the 'goose that lays the golden eggs.' The comment reflects Trump's perspective on maintaining US technological dominance in the AI sector, though no specific policies or threats were detailed in the source.
